×

Hupspot calendar invites guide

How to Add Calendar Invites to Hubspot Marketing Emails

Using Hubspot to deliver event promotions is powerful, but the platform does not insert native calendar events directly into marketing emails. Instead, you can add links that let contacts download calendar files or open browser-based calendar apps so they can quickly save your event.

This guide walks through practical, compliant ways to share calendar invites from tools like Outlook and Google Calendar, while sending the invites through Hubspot marketing emails.

Key limitations of Hubspot marketing email calendar invites

Before setting anything up, it is important to understand what Hubspot supports and what it does not support.

  • Hubspot marketing emails cannot generate live calendar events inside the email editor.
  • You must first create the event in a calendar tool (such as Outlook or Google Calendar).
  • You then add a link or file download to your Hubspot email so recipients can add the event.

The strategies below follow these rules while keeping your campaigns clear and user friendly.

Method 1: Use ICS files with your Hubspot marketing emails

An ICS file is a standard calendar file format that most calendar apps can read. You can attach or link to an ICS file from your Hubspot email so recipients can download and add the event to their calendars.

Create an ICS file from your calendar tool

First, create the calendar event using your preferred calendar application. The steps vary slightly by provider, but the overall process is similar.

  1. Create a new calendar event with title, date, time, and location.
  2. Add the event description, agenda, and any relevant links.
  3. Save the event to your calendar.
  4. Export or download the event as an ICS file (often labeled as “Export event” or “Save as .ics”).

Once you have the ICS file saved to your computer, you are ready to add it into your Hubspot marketing workflow.

Upload the ICS file and link it in a Hubspot email

To let your contacts download the ICS file from your email, upload it to your file manager and then use a link or button in the email body.

  1. Sign in to your Hubspot account and open the marketing email tool.
  2. Go to your file manager and upload the ICS file you exported.
  3. Copy the shareable file URL from your file manager.
  4. Edit your email and highlight the text or button you want to use, such as “Add to Calendar”.
  5. Insert the ICS file URL as the link destination.
  6. Save and test your email to ensure the download works properly.

Recipients who click the link will download the ICS file and can open it with their default calendar application.

Method 2: Use Google Calendar links in Hubspot emails

If you use Google Calendar, you can generate a browser-based event link that opens directly in Google Calendar. This method is convenient for users already on Google Workspace, and it works seamlessly inside Hubspot marketing emails.

Create a shareable Google Calendar event link

Start by building the event inside Google Calendar, then create a link that guests can use to add the event to their calendars.

  1. Open Google Calendar and create a new event with all event details.
  2. Configure the correct time zone and location to avoid confusion.
  3. Save the event in your calendar.
  4. Open the event details and locate the public sharing or “publish event” options.
  5. Copy the generated Google Calendar event URL.

This URL lets contacts open the event directly in their Google Calendar, where they can add it with one click.

Add the Google Calendar link to your Hubspot email

With the event URL ready, you can place it into any section of your marketing email.

  1. In Hubspot, open the email editor for the campaign promoting your event.
  2. Decide where to place your call-to-action, such as in a button or text link.
  3. Highlight the text or select the button and insert the Google Calendar event URL.
  4. Use descriptive anchor text, such as “Save this event to Google Calendar”.
  5. Send yourself a test email and click the link to validate the behavior.

When recipients click the link, they are taken to Google Calendar and can quickly add the event to their own calendars.

Method 3: Link to an event landing page from Hubspot

Another reliable approach is to create an event landing page that contains calendar links, then drive traffic to that page from your Hubspot marketing email.

Build an event landing page with calendar options

You can host the event landing page in Hubspot or on another CMS. The page should make it easy for visitors to add your event to their calendars.

  • Include full event details: title, date, time, and description.
  • Add separate “Add to Calendar” options such as:
    • Download ICS file
    • Google Calendar link
    • Other calendar providers as needed
  • Place the main call-to-action clearly above the fold.

This page acts as a central hub for calendar actions, which you can reuse in multiple Hubspot emails and other channels.

Drive traffic to the landing page from Hubspot emails

After your landing page is ready, focus your Hubspot email on getting clicks to that page.

  1. Open the Hubspot email editor and craft your event invitation copy.
  2. Insert one or more buttons with text such as “View Event Details” or “RSVP & Add to Calendar”.
  3. Link those buttons and text to your event landing page URL.
  4. Use UTM parameters if you want to track performance in analytics.
  5. Preview and test the email before sending to your list.

This strategy lets you update calendar options in one place (the landing page) without editing every Hubspot email you already sent or scheduled.

Best practices for calendar invites in Hubspot campaigns

To get the best results when adding event invites to Hubspot marketing emails, keep these best practices in mind.

  • Make the call-to-action obvious: Use clear button labels like “Add to Calendar” or “Save the Date”.
  • Support multiple calendar tools: Provide at least an ICS file plus a Google Calendar link when possible.
  • Test in different email clients: Send test emails to several devices and inboxes to confirm file downloads and links behave as expected.
  • Provide all key details in the email: Even if contacts do not click the link, they should still understand the time and purpose of the event.
  • Follow permission and compliance standards: Only email contacts who have opted in, and respect your organization’s data policies.

Where to learn more about Hubspot email features

To go deeper into the limitations and supported approaches for calendar invites in marketing emails, review the official documentation directly from the platform. You can find the original source information here: official Hubspot knowledge base article on calendar invites.

If you are building a broader email and automation strategy that uses Hubspot alongside other platforms, you may also find it useful to work with specialists focused on CRM, marketing operations, and automation. For additional strategic and technical resources, see Consultevo.

Summary: Using calendar invites effectively with Hubspot

Because marketing emails cannot generate native calendar events inside Hubspot, you must rely on links and downloadable files to help contacts add events. By creating ICS files, generating Google Calendar URLs, or driving subscribers to a dedicated event landing page, you can still give your audience an easy way to save your webinars, demos, or in-person events.

Combine these methods with clear calls-to-action, thorough testing, and accurate event details to ensure that your Hubspot campaigns reliably drive attendance and engagement for every event you promote.

Need Help With Hubspot?

If you want expert help building, automating, or scaling your Hubspot , work with ConsultEvo, a team who has a decade of Hubspot experience.

Scale Hubspot

“`

Verified by MonsterInsights